RECIPE NOTE…Because of the alcohol content these do not completely freeze.  But they will harden enough to form an ice pops

Pina Colada Ice Pops

(Makes about 12 Pops)

2 Cups – Fresh Pineapple-cubed and frozen

⅓ Cup of Coco Lopez – cream of coconut

½ Cup of Unsweetened Coconut Milk

4 oz. White Rum 

2 oz. Coconut Rum

2 tbsp. Fresh Lime Juice 

3 to 4 oz. Plastic Ice Pops/Popsicles- I got the sleeves on Amazon 

In a blender combine all the ingredients and purée. Fill ice pops to right below the seal using a funnel. Seal the pop and put in a vessel that will keep them upright in the freeze. Freeze for at least 5 hours and serve.
